summ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orP. J. McDermott <pj@pehjota.net>2014-07-31 19:55:37 (EDT)
committer P. J. McDermott <pj@pehjota.net>2014-07-31 19:55:37 (EDT)
commitbb5dae2360edb65ef113ebdf4aa64279fe688448 (patch)
treec572b4b5095381675692f343f7586e9594f81f76
parentbae34a9cc0ef66bae8964473e818d8148b240a1a (diff)
Add binary packages
Fourteen of them.
-rwxr-xr-xbuild2
-rw-r--r--libnl-3-dev.pkg/control3
-rw-r--r--libnl-3-dev.pkg/files4
-rw-r--r--libnl-3.200.pkg/control3
-rw-r--r--libnl-3.200.pkg/docs0
-rw-r--r--libnl-3.200.pkg/files1
-rw-r--r--libnl-cli-3-dev.pkg/control3
-rw-r--r--libnl-cli-3-dev.pkg/files5
-rw-r--r--libnl-cli-3.200.pkg/control6
-rw-r--r--libnl-cli-3.200.pkg/files2
-rw-r--r--libnl-genl-3-dev.pkg/control3
-rw-r--r--libnl-genl-3-dev.pkg/files4
-rw-r--r--libnl-genl-3.200.pkg/control3
-rw-r--r--libnl-genl-3.200.pkg/files1
-rw-r--r--libnl-idiag-3-dev.pkg/control3
-rw-r--r--libnl-idiag-3-dev.pkg/files3
-rw-r--r--libnl-idiag-3.200.pkg/control3
-rw-r--r--libnl-idiag-3.200.pkg/files1
-rw-r--r--libnl-nf-3-dev.pkg/control3
-rw-r--r--libnl-nf-3-dev.pkg/files4
-rw-r--r--libnl-nf-3.200.pkg/control4
-rw-r--r--libnl-nf-3.200.pkg/files1
-rw-r--r--libnl-route-3-dev.pkg/control3
-rw-r--r--libnl-route-3-dev.pkg/files5
-rw-r--r--libnl-route-3.200.pkg/control3
-rw-r--r--libnl-route-3.200.pkg/files2
-rw-r--r--libnl-utils-doc.pkg/control3
-rw-r--r--libnl-utils-doc.pkg/files1
-rw-r--r--libnl-utils.pkg/control3
-rw-r--r--libnl-utils.pkg/files1
30 files changed, 83 insertions, 0 deletions
diff --git a/build b/build
index 67a7023..bf6f41e 100755
--- a/build
+++ b/build
@@ -12,6 +12,8 @@ build:
install: build
oh-autoinstall
+ rm dest/usr/lib/$(OPK_HOST_ARCH)/*.la
+ rm dest/usr/lib/$(OPK_HOST_ARCH)/libnl/cli/*/*.la
oh-fixperms
oh-strip
oh-installfiles
diff --git a/libnl-3-dev.pkg/control b/libnl-3-dev.pkg/control
new file mode 100644
index 0000000..ab73fd0
--- /dev/null
+++ b/libnl-3-dev.pkg/control
@@ -0,0 +1,3 @@
+Architecture: any-linux-any
+Platform: all
+Depends: libnl-3.200 (= ${Binary-Version})
diff --git a/libnl-3-dev.pkg/files b/libnl-3-dev.pkg/files
new file mode 100644
index 0000000..ecc78dd
--- /dev/null
+++ b/libnl-3-dev.pkg/files
@@ -0,0 +1,4 @@
+/usr/include/libnl3/netlink/*.h
+/usr/lib/*/libnl-3.so
+/usr/lib/*/libnl-3.a
+/usr/lib/*/pkgconfig/libnl-3.0.pc
diff --git a/libnl-3.200.pkg/control b/libnl-3.200.pkg/control
new file mode 100644
index 0000000..ab73fd0
--- /dev/null
+++ b/libnl-3.200.pkg/control
@@ -0,0 +1,3 @@
+Architecture: any-linux-any
+Platform: all
+Depends: libnl-3.200 (= ${Binary-Version})
diff --git a/libnl-3.200.pkg/docs b/libnl-3.200.pkg/docs
new file mode 100644
index 0000000..e69de29
--- /dev/null
+++ b/libnl-3.200.pkg/docs
diff --git a/libnl-3.200.pkg/files b/libnl-3.200.pkg/files
new file mode 100644
index 0000000..ef3b2a9
--- /dev/null
+++ b/libnl-3.200.pkg/files
@@ -0,0 +1 @@
+/usr/lib/*/libnl-3.so.*
diff --git a/libnl-cli-3-dev.pkg/control b/libnl-cli-3-dev.pkg/control
new file mode 100644
index 0000000..ab73fd0
--- /dev/null
+++ b/libnl-cli-3-dev.pkg/control
@@ -0,0 +1,3 @@
+Architecture: any-linux-any
+Platform: all
+Depends: libnl-3.200 (= ${Binary-Version})
diff --git a/libnl-cli-3-dev.pkg/files b/libnl-cli-3-dev.pkg/files
new file mode 100644
index 0000000..6bad29c
--- /dev/null
+++ b/libnl-cli-3-dev.pkg/files
@@ -0,0 +1,5 @@
+/usr/include/libnl3/netlink/cli/
+/usr/lib/*/libnl-cli-3.so
+/usr/lib/*/libnl-cli-3.a
+/usr/lib/*/libnl/cli/*/*.a
+/usr/lib/*/pkgconfig/libnl-cli-3.0.pc
diff --git a/libnl-cli-3.200.pkg/control b/libnl-cli-3.200.pkg/control
new file mode 100644
index 0000000..7e305ed
--- /dev/null
+++ b/libnl-cli-3.200.pkg/control
@@ -0,0 +1,6 @@
+Architecture: any-linux-any
+Platform: all
+Depends: libnl-3.200 (= ${Binary-Version}),
+ libnl-nf-3.200 (= ${Binary-Version}),
+ libnl-route-3.200 (= ${Binary-Version}),
+ libnl-genl-3.200 (= ${Binary-Version}),
diff --git a/libnl-cli-3.200.pkg/files b/libnl-cli-3.200.pkg/files
new file mode 100644
index 0000000..216f67d
--- /dev/null
+++ b/libnl-cli-3.200.pkg/files
@@ -0,0 +1,2 @@
+/usr/lib/*/libnl-cli-3.so.*
+/usr/lib/*/libnl/cli/*/*.so
diff --git a/libnl-genl-3-dev.pkg/control b/libnl-genl-3-dev.pkg/control
new file mode 100644
index 0000000..ab73fd0
--- /dev/null
+++ b/libnl-genl-3-dev.pkg/control
@@ -0,0 +1,3 @@
+Architecture: any-linux-any
+Platform: all
+Depends: libnl-3.200 (= ${Binary-Version})
diff --git a/libnl-genl-3-dev.pkg/files b/libnl-genl-3-dev.pkg/files
new file mode 100644
index 0000000..53d9c08
--- /dev/null
+++ b/libnl-genl-3-dev.pkg/files
@@ -0,0 +1,4 @@
+/usr/include/libnl3/netlink/genl/
+/usr/lib/*/libnl-genl-3.so
+/usr/lib/*/libnl-genl-3.a
+/usr/lib/*/pkgconfig/libnl-genl-3.0.pc
diff --git a/libnl-genl-3.200.pkg/control b/libnl-genl-3.200.pkg/control
new file mode 100644
index 0000000..ab73fd0
--- /dev/null
+++ b/libnl-genl-3.200.pkg/control
@@ -0,0 +1,3 @@
+Architecture: any-linux-any
+Platform: all
+Depends: libnl-3.200 (= ${Binary-Version})
diff --git a/libnl-genl-3.200.pkg/files b/libnl-genl-3.200.pkg/files
new file mode 100644
index 0000000..c9f2708
--- /dev/null
+++ b/libnl-genl-3.200.pkg/files
@@ -0,0 +1 @@
+/usr/lib/*/libnl-genl-3.so.*
diff --git a/libnl-idiag-3-dev.pkg/control b/libnl-idiag-3-dev.pkg/control
new file mode 100644
index 0000000..ab73fd0
--- /dev/null
+++ b/libnl-idiag-3-dev.pkg/control
@@ -0,0 +1,3 @@
+Architecture: any-linux-any
+Platform: all
+Depends: libnl-3.200 (= ${Binary-Version})
diff --git a/libnl-idiag-3-dev.pkg/files b/libnl-idiag-3-dev.pkg/files
new file mode 100644
index 0000000..924049b
--- /dev/null
+++ b/libnl-idiag-3-dev.pkg/files
@@ -0,0 +1,3 @@
+/usr/include/libnl3/netlink/idiag/
+/usr/lib/*/libnl-idiag-3.so
+/usr/lib/*/libnl-idiag-3.a
diff --git a/libnl-idiag-3.200.pkg/control b/libnl-idiag-3.200.pkg/control
new file mode 100644
index 0000000..ab73fd0
--- /dev/null
+++ b/libnl-idiag-3.200.pkg/control
@@ -0,0 +1,3 @@
+Architecture: any-linux-any
+Platform: all
+Depends: libnl-3.200 (= ${Binary-Version})
diff --git a/libnl-idiag-3.200.pkg/files b/libnl-idiag-3.200.pkg/files
new file mode 100644
index 0000000..771478d
--- /dev/null
+++ b/libnl-idiag-3.200.pkg/files
@@ -0,0 +1 @@
+/usr/lib/*/libnl-idiag-3.so.*
diff --git a/libnl-nf-3-dev.pkg/control b/libnl-nf-3-dev.pkg/control
new file mode 100644
index 0000000..ab73fd0
--- /dev/null
+++ b/libnl-nf-3-dev.pkg/control
@@ -0,0 +1,3 @@
+Architecture: any-linux-any
+Platform: all
+Depends: libnl-3.200 (= ${Binary-Version})
diff --git a/libnl-nf-3-dev.pkg/files b/libnl-nf-3-dev.pkg/files
new file mode 100644
index 0000000..4b4a51e
--- /dev/null
+++ b/libnl-nf-3-dev.pkg/files
@@ -0,0 +1,4 @@
+/usr/include/libnl3/netlink/netfilter/
+/usr/lib/*/libnl-nf-3.so
+/usr/lib/*/libnl-nf-3.a
+/usr/lib/*/pkgconfig/libnl-nf-3.0.pc
diff --git a/libnl-nf-3.200.pkg/control b/libnl-nf-3.200.pkg/control
new file mode 100644
index 0000000..542cd5b
--- /dev/null
+++ b/libnl-nf-3.200.pkg/control
@@ -0,0 +1,4 @@
+Architecture: any-linux-any
+Platform: all
+Depends: libnl-3.200 (= ${Binary-Version}),
+ libnl-route-3.200 (= ${Binary-Version})
diff --git a/libnl-nf-3.200.pkg/files b/libnl-nf-3.200.pkg/files
new file mode 100644
index 0000000..80f501f
--- /dev/null
+++ b/libnl-nf-3.200.pkg/files
@@ -0,0 +1 @@
+/usr/lib/*/libnl-nf-3.so.*
diff --git a/libnl-route-3-dev.pkg/control b/libnl-route-3-dev.pkg/control
new file mode 100644
index 0000000..ab73fd0
--- /dev/null
+++ b/libnl-route-3-dev.pkg/control
@@ -0,0 +1,3 @@
+Architecture: any-linux-any
+Platform: all
+Depends: libnl-3.200 (= ${Binary-Version})
diff --git a/libnl-route-3-dev.pkg/files b/libnl-route-3-dev.pkg/files
new file mode 100644
index 0000000..cf6c89d
--- /dev/null
+++ b/libnl-route-3-dev.pkg/files
@@ -0,0 +1,5 @@
+/usr/include/libnl3/netlink/route/
+/usr/include/libnl3/netlink/fib_lookup/
+/usr/lib/*/libnl-route-3.so
+/usr/lib/*/libnl-route-3.a
+/usr/lib/*/pkgconfig/libnl-route-3.0.pc
diff --git a/libnl-route-3.200.pkg/control b/libnl-route-3.200.pkg/control
new file mode 100644
index 0000000..ab73fd0
--- /dev/null
+++ b/libnl-route-3.200.pkg/control
@@ -0,0 +1,3 @@
+Architecture: any-linux-any
+Platform: all
+Depends: libnl-3.200 (= ${Binary-Version})
diff --git a/libnl-route-3.200.pkg/files b/libnl-route-3.200.pkg/files
new file mode 100644
index 0000000..1a4d650
--- /dev/null
+++ b/libnl-route-3.200.pkg/files
@@ -0,0 +1,2 @@
+/usr/lib/*/libnl-route-3.so.*
+/etc/
diff --git a/libnl-utils-doc.pkg/control b/libnl-utils-doc.pkg/control
new file mode 100644
index 0000000..e6c1a46
--- /dev/null
+++ b/libnl-utils-doc.pkg/control
@@ -0,0 +1,3 @@
+Architecture: all
+Platform: all
+Depends: libnl-3.200 (>= ${Source-Version})
diff --git a/libnl-utils-doc.pkg/files b/libnl-utils-doc.pkg/files
new file mode 100644
index 0000000..c4bdb4f
--- /dev/null
+++ b/libnl-utils-doc.pkg/files
@@ -0,0 +1 @@
+/usr/share/man/man8/
diff --git a/libnl-utils.pkg/control b/libnl-utils.pkg/control
new file mode 100644
index 0000000..ab73fd0
--- /dev/null
+++ b/libnl-utils.pkg/control
@@ -0,0 +1,3 @@
+Architecture: any-linux-any
+Platform: all
+Depends: libnl-3.200 (= ${Binary-Version})
diff --git a/libnl-utils.pkg/files b/libnl-utils.pkg/files
new file mode 100644
index 0000000..d60cf9d
--- /dev/null
+++ b/libnl-utils.pkg/files
@@ -0,0 +1 @@
+/usr/sbin/